After 32 years of service, Earleen Reimann is retiring from Hillsboro PD—and with her goes a legacy built on trust, connection, and compassion.

As one of our longtime Community Engagement Specialists, Earleen helped connect our police department with the community. Her impact reaches far beyond the job.

Thank you, Earleen. Hillsboro is better because of you.
